Transaction 7c7d364cf8620885ade64b1026d27f22530ef79ede1ab53b0023f425d2314894

1 Input
2 Outputs
  • 7c7d364cf8620885ade64b1026d27f22530ef79ede1ab53b0023f425d2314894:0
  • value  427430000
    address  166bhVYaDCUR6vMDLeRrCYcq2wqTaMy5ef
  • 7c7d364cf8620885ade64b1026d27f22530ef79ede1ab53b0023f425d2314894:1
  • value  540390000
    address  17zfi88tKTzfw4m6NcDBpU8GoRib4JTdMg